Enterprise software solved operations — not reasoning.
ERP, CRM and the systems that followed digitized how work is recorded and executed. They made organizations more efficient, but they never captured how the organization thinks: the judgment, context and precedent behind consequential decisions.
AI creates a genuinely new opportunity.
For the first time, an organization can capture what it knows, make its reasoning explicit, and operate over all of it continuously. This is not a faster tool bolted onto old workflows — it is a new layer of the organization itself.
Institutional memory is now an asset, not an accident.
The knowledge that lives in experienced people — why decisions were made, what was tried, what worked — can finally be preserved as a durable institutional asset that survives departures, reorganizations and leadership change.
Executive judgment becomes strategic infrastructure.
When the reasoning behind decisions is explicit and reviewable, judgment stops being a personal trait and becomes an organizational capability — one that can be examined, improved and compounded across every leader and every decision.
Organizations must become continuously learning systems.
The advantage no longer belongs to the organization with the most data or the newest model. It belongs to the one that learns fastest and forgets least — a continuously learning system that gets measurably smarter with every decision.
